5 Ways To Use The Corners Of Your House
Create An Extra Movable Sitting Area
If you are someone who hosts parties and has a lot of visitors coming over, an extra sitting area will be a plus. When you don’t feel the need for extra sitting space, you can create a movable or foldable furniture piece. Many interior designers create classic corner furniture pieces that you can swiftly move from one place to another. In this way, you get both convenience and comfort.
Structure With A Few Shelves
Once a traditional way of setting up a corner, shelves are now long gone. But you can bring the trend back with a slight quirkiness to it. Make a single shelf and stack it up with your favourite things or make different shelves at a gap of few centimetres and decorate with your artefacts. To brighten it up, you can add a few spotlights or even place a few fairy lights for the raw effect.
Get Creative With A Photo Wall
Going with the millennial trend of photo walls, you can give your corners a new look. For photo walls, you can collect pictures from your favourite vacation and get those printed in horizontal format and stick those in heart shape, where half of the heart is on one wall and another half on another wall. If you want to add a luxurious touch to your photo wall, you can use black or golden colour frames.
Stack Up Your Favourite Books
Whether it is a splendid spacious apartment in Goregaon or a confined 1BHK flat, if you are a book lover, the idea of a corner library can never go wrong. For the people who believe in keeping it raw, you can try a hanging readymade bookshelf, and for the people who wish to make it grand can build an L-shaped library that elevates your corners.
Rock It With A Swing
The mesmerising thing about corners is you can refurbish them into your own cosy space, which you can call your favourite spot. To create it, hang a hammock swing, place a circular rug, and decorate it with little lanterns. The other way of doing it is by placing a mattress, stacking it up with colourful pillows, and enhancing the area around with little planters.
